I was fiddling with Adobe Configurator to see if it would be a good medium for tutorials. I whipped this tutorial up in just a few minutes (it's just my old faux curtain tutorial, get excited about Configurator, not my tutorial).
It was 100% WYSIWYG and required no coding or scripting of any kind.
If you have Photoshop CS4 (sorry, earlier versions can't use it) just put the folder included in this zip file into your Panels directory. Then restart Photoshop CS4 and load it via the Window>Extensions menu.
